BRITNEY Spears has revealed she’s Catholic, 23 years after the singer dressed as a schoolgirl in the video for her first hit Baby One More Time.
Taking to Instagram on Thursday with her latest post, the 39-year-old star showed off a flowing blue dress which she declared was her “sexy Mass dress.”

In the clip Britney twirled to model the plunging frock to her fans as she wrote: “I just got back from mass … I’m Catholic now … let us pray !!!”
LOUISIANA GOOD GIRL
Britney, who was brought up in a strict Christian Baptist household in Louisiana, made waves as she dressed as a Catholic schoolgirl in her debut video Baby One More Time, which launched her to pop culture icon status in 1998.
The racy look consisted of a black skirt, white unbuttoned blouse tied at the midriff, knee socks, and gray cardigan. Brit finished the look with girly pigtails.
Early in her career the pop star talked openly about how important her virginity was to her, as she faced criticism for wearing raunchy outfits on stage.
“I’m a Christian. I go to church. But my mom taught us, ‘Don’t be ashamed of your body. It’s a beautiful thing,'” Britney once said.
In recent years, however, the Gimme More hitmaker has not publicly discussed her religious beliefs but in a 2020 Instagram post of her posing outside a church, the singer wrote: “Always take time to go to church even on vacation.”

LEGAL BATTLE
The post comes after Britney’s new lawyer demanded her father Jamie Spears be removed “immediately” from her conservatorship.
On Thursday, the singer’s new attorney Mathew Rosengart filed legal docs asking the judge to move up the hearing date to remove Jamie from late September to August, according to court documents obtained by The Sun.

Mathew’s most recent request demanded Judge Penny move the September 29 hearing up to August 23, 2021.
According to the docs, that date is the “soonest” available court date on the calendar.
The legal papers continue to state: “Conservatee moves for the immediate suspension of James P. Spears as Conservator and the appointment of Jason Rubin as Temporary Conservator pending the hearing presently set for September 29, 2021.”
